Qualcomm to Acquire Arduino, Advancing Edge AI Development

Qualcomm Technologies, Inc., global industry experts in advanced computing, connectivity, and artificial intelligence, has announced its agreement to acquire Arduino. The transaction supports Qualcomm’s strategy to expand developer access to its leading-edge AI and edge-computing technologies. Microchip Intros FPGA Ethernet Sensor Bridge for Real-time Edge AI

Microchip Technology has announced the release of its PolarFire® FPGA Ethernet Sensor Bridge, a new solution designed to enable the development of artificial intelligence (AI)-driven sensor processing systems compatible with NVIDIA’s Holoscan platform. OnLogic Debits Axial AC101 Edge Server for Network Edge, IIoT, AI, ML

OnLogic announces the global launch of its Axial AC101 Edge Server, designed for Network Edge, Industrial Internet of Things (IIoT), Machine Learning (ML), and Artificial Intelligence (AI) applications reliant on efficient data access at the edge. Microchip Technology Acquires Neuronix AI Labs

Microchip Technology (Nasdaq: MCHP) has recently announced its acquisition of Neuronix AI Labs to enhance its power-efficient, AI-enabled edge solutions deployed on field-programmable gate arrays (FPGAs).
